Our combi boiler broke, and ever since it was fixed (by way of a new thermostat apparently...) we have been unable to get a decent flow of hot water from the mixer shower or the bath. Other hot water taps are all working as before. When I turn the shower/bath to maximum temperature I can get a warm flow for about 30 seconds then it goes cold again and I have to turn the shower off for about 60 seconds before I can get a warm flow again. Also, if I run the hot bath tap slowly to keep the flow hot I've noticed that sometimes the water pressure drops off to a dribble, at which point the boiler thermostat will show the temperature in the boiler increase to very hot temperatures - if I now turn the tap on full extremely hot water will come out. Any ideas what the problem is??? Thanks. |
